区块链钱包开发:选择合适的开发平台与服务

                发布时间:2025-11-09 07:33:33

                引言

                近年来,区块链技术的发展使得各种新兴应用层出不穷,其中数字钱包的普及程度逐渐提高。区块链钱包作为一种存储、管理和交易加密货币的重要工具,受到了广泛关注。在这一背景下,越来越多的公司和个人开始探索区块链钱包的开发,以求满足市场日益增长的需求。然而,许多人对于区块链钱包的开发过程、平台选择及相关技术的掌握仍有诸多疑问。本文将深入探讨区块链钱包开发的相关内容,并回答常见的问题。

                什么是区块链钱包?

                区块链钱包开发:选择合适的开发平台与服务

                区块链钱包是一种用于存储和管理加密货币的应用程序或设备。它基于区块链技术,能够安全地存储用户的公钥和私钥,并允许用户发送和接收加密资产。区块链钱包大致分为热钱包和冷钱包两种类型。

                热钱包通常在线使用,可以方便地进行交易;而冷钱包则是离线存储,更加安全,但交易时需要手动转移资产。在区块链钱包中,私钥是用户控制其加密货币的唯一凭证,因此保护好私钥至关重要。

                区块链钱包开发的必要性

                随着市场上加密货币越来越多,区块链钱包的开发成为了数字资产管理的一个重要组成部分。企业和个人都希望通过开发自己的钱包来控制资产的使用,甚至提供给其他用户使用。开发区块链钱包既能够提供简单的资产存储和交易,还是一个商业机会,吸引用户并为他们提供良好的体验。

                此外,区块链钱包的功能日益丰富,包括支持多种加密货币、集成去中心化金融(DeFi)服务、与NFT市场的交互等,为用户提供更多的选择和便利。

                区块链钱包开发需要考虑的因素

                区块链钱包开发:选择合适的开发平台与服务

                进行区块链钱包开发时,有几个关键的技术和市场因素需要考虑:

                1. 安全性

                安全性是区块链钱包开发中最重要的考虑因素之一。黑客攻击和资产盗取事件屡见不鲜,因此开发者需要采取多种安全措施,确保用户的资金安全。包括加密算法、双重身份验证以及冷存储选项都是常见的安全措施。

                2. 用户体验

                在竞争激烈的市场中,用户体验决定了钱包的受欢迎程度。开发者需要关注界面的友好性、交易速度以及客户支持等方面,以便提高用户的留存率和活跃度。

                3. 法规遵从

                各国对于加密货币的法律法规差异较大,开发区块链钱包时要确保符合相关的法律要求。这可能包括反洗钱(AML)和了解客户(KYC)的规定,确保合规性。

                4. 目标市场

                明确目标用户群体对钱包的功能和设计要求会产生直接影响。开发者需要通过市场调研,了解目标用户的需求和痛点,进而提供相应的解决方案。

                常见问题及解答

                1. 哪里可以找到优质的区块链钱包开发服务?

                要寻找优质的区块链钱包开发服务,首先可以通过多个途径进行搜索。例如,通过相关行业的展会,技术论坛,甚至专业的开发者社区,了解这些服务的评价与口碑。另外,一些知名的区块链开发公司也提供定制化的钱包开发服务,确保产品符合具体需求。

                可以在网络上查找案例研究,以找到成功的区块链钱包开发公司,比较它们的项目 Portfolio,注意他们以往客户的反馈。此外,LinkedIn、Freelancer、Upwork 等专业平台也是寻找区块链开发者和企业的好去处。

                在选择开发服务时,需要关注其技术能力、团队经验与客户服务,明确合作条款,确保开发进程顺利进行。

                2. 开发一个区块链钱包需要多长时间?

                开发区块链钱包的时间长短受多种因素的影响,尤其是钱包的类型、功能复杂性与团队规模等。有些基本的钱包,可能只需要几周的时间,而功能齐全的钱包则可能需要数月。

                具体来说,开发时间可以细分为几个阶段:需求定义、设计、开发、测试和部署。其中,需求定义阶段需要与客户进行深入的交流,确保理解其需求。设计阶段,则需要考虑用户界面及体验。开发和测试是时间最消耗的部分,尤其是要确保钱包的安全性和可用性。

                开发团队的经验和技术熟练程度也会直接影响开发时长,因此选择一个有经验的团队非常重要。根据行业普遍的经验,多数高质量钱包的开发周期在3个月到6个月之间。

                3. 开发区块链钱包的成本大概是多少?

                开发区块链钱包的成本主要与其设计复杂性、功能需求和开发团队的地域差异等相关。一般来说,简单的热钱包开发成本会相对较低,通常在几千到几万美金之间,而高度自定义和功能丰富的钱包开发则可能超过十万美元。

                具体的成本可分为如下几个部分:设计成本、开发成本、测试成本和后续维护成本。设计和开发是初期的主要费用,而后续的费用包括系统升级、安全性维护及客户支持。开发者需要提前与服务提供者沟通,以评估这个项目的全部成本,并放置在预算范围之内。

                此外,还要考虑到是否需要持续的技术支持和更新。一些服务商提供固定的维护费用,也有一些以小时计费,选择合适的付费结构可以在未来降低长期成本。

                4. 区块链钱包开发的最佳技术栈是什么?

                区块链钱包的开发涉及众多技术,选择合适的技术栈对钱包的成功至关重要。以下是一些建议的技术栈和工具:

                对于后端开发,常用的语言包括 JavaScript (Node.js)、Python 和 Golang。这几种语言都有丰富的库和社区支持,适合进行区块链相关开发。数据库部分,MongoDB 和 PostgreSQL 是较为常用的选择。

                在前端开发中,React、Vue 和 Angular 都是流行的技术框架,能够帮助开发者创建良好的用户体验。应配合 HTML、CSS 与 JavaScript 开展工作。

                安全性方面,可采用标准的加密算法(如AES、RSA)和钱包框架(如 HD Wallets),以确保资产的安全与隐私。

                最后,确保有完善的API接口,以便支持资产的转账和数据交换,这也是开发过程中不可或缺的部分。

                结语

                区块链钱包的开发是一个复杂但充满机会的领域。随着区块链技术的不断进步,开发者可以探索更广泛的功能与应用,满足用户的各种需求。希望本文能为那些有意向进入这一领域的开发者提供一些实用的见解和指导。

                分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                        相关新闻

                                                        如何申请比特币钱包及使
                                                        2024-02-10
                                                        如何申请比特币钱包及使

                                                        1. 什么是比特币钱包? 比特币钱包是一种用于存储、发送和接收比特币的数字货币钱包。它类似于传统的钱包,但是...

                                                        如何登录比特币钱包
                                                        2024-01-07
                                                        如何登录比特币钱包

                                                        什么是比特币钱包 比特币钱包是一种用来存储和管理比特币的软件或服务。它允许用户生成比特币地址,并与区块链...

                                                        三星区块链钱包S10: 安全、
                                                        2024-03-04
                                                        三星区块链钱包S10: 安全、

                                                        什么是三星区块链钱包S10? 三星区块链钱包S10是一款由三星公司开发的手机应用程序,旨在为用户提供便捷、安全的...

                                                                                          <em dir="b1t"></em><em date-time="1x9"></em><time date-time="5l3"></time><address lang="y6u"></address><dl draggable="alw"></dl><ins id="34q"></ins><dfn date-time="mnj"></dfn><font draggable="xqs"></font><map draggable="gnz"></map><dfn draggable="8qw"></dfn><b lang="yyy"></b><strong date-time="f4h"></strong><kbd id="f19"></kbd><em dropzone="tt0"></em><strong date-time="g1p"></strong><ins dir="she"></ins><var draggable="g_l"></var><ul dropzone="m49"></ul><ol id="zlq"></ol><area dropzone="hl5"></area><b lang="7ce"></b><small draggable="moo"></small><abbr date-time="6fj"></abbr><tt draggable="8l7"></tt><del date-time="7au"></del><b dir="jnh"></b><del dir="1x_"></del><bdo dropzone="o6g"></bdo><font date-time="73m"></font><i date-time="08s"></i><kbd dir="tli"></kbd><legend dropzone="vx8"></legend><noframes lang="2zi">

                                                                                                                              标签